Professor Cara Tomlinson invited to participate in the Art in the Governor’s Office Program
December 14, 2011
Professor Tomlinson has been in to be part of an exhibition of Oregon artists that are exhibited in the Governor’s office. The exhibit runs from December 14th through February 22nd.
Managed by the Arts Commission, the program honors professional, living Oregon artists with exhibitions in the Governor’s ceremonial office in the State Capitol. The ten-week solo exhibits offer visitors to the Governor’s Office—be they elected officials, foreign dignitaries, students, or business, civic or cultural leaders—a glimpse into the talent of our state’s visual artists.
